Assisting Species at Risk Several (10) trout species are at risk of predation as a result of sea lamprey (an exotic species) populations in Paw Paw Lake Pollution Mitigation Non-Point Source Pollution
Other (describe)
Construct an inflatable dam to act as barrier to prevent the sea lampreys from getting into Paw Paw Lake, disturbing the balance of fish communities.
The feasibility phase is underway. No benefits have been quantified to date.
Lead: COE
The COE will provide 75% of the total project cost.
The Great Lakes Fishery Commission will provide 25% of the total project cost.
